4 specialized high schools in Ho Chi Minh City to admit over 2,300 10th-grade students

Four specialized high schools in Ho Chi Minh City are recruiting over 2,300 students nationwide for the 10th grade, an increase of 105 compared to last year.

On 14/4, Nguyen Thi Be Hien, Principal of Le Hong Phong Specialized High School, stated that the school plans to admit 805 10th-grade students, consistent with previous years. This school has the largest admission quota among specialized schools in the city.

Similarly, Tran Dai Nghia Specialized High School also maintains its quota of 525 students.

Meanwhile, Hung Vuong Specialized High School in Binh Duong province plans to open a Japanese language class for 35 students, raising its total quota to 455. Le Quy Don Specialized High School in Ba Ria - Vung Tau province is increasing its 10th-grade capacity by 70 seats by opening new specialized history and geography classes. Its total quota is 525 students.

The 10th-grade admission quotas for the four specialized schools in Ho Chi Minh City for 2026 are as follows:

The public 10th-grade entrance examination in Ho Chi Minh City will take place on 1-2/6. Candidates wishing to enter a specialized school must take four subjects: Mathematics, Literature, a foreign language (primarily English), and a specialized subject test. The admission score is the sum of the three general subject test scores, plus the specialized subject score multiplied by 2.

Students will register their 10th-grade preferences online from 22/4 to 28/4. Candidates from outside Ho Chi Minh City must submit their applications directly to Le Hong Phong Specialized High School.

Students can register for a maximum of 8 preferences, including three general preferences, two specialized preferences, and three integrated preferences. The Department of Education and Training will announce the number of first preferences for each school by 4/5 at the latest, allowing students to make adjustments between 4/5 and 8/5.
